Cultural Background

In the thirteenth century, Mongol forces had invaded China, and established the Yuan Dynasty in 1271. After a series of Mongol invasions, Goryeo eventually capitulated and made a peace treaty with the Yuan dynasty. The Ming Dynasty in China had grown extremely powerful during the 14th century, however, and began to beat back the Yuan forces, so that by the 1350s Goryeo had regained its northern territories, and took back the Liaodong region.
